Definitions:

Actuarial Assumptions

Hypothetical conditions used for projecting financial or insurance outcomes, involving demographic, economic, and other factors.

Prior Service Cost

The cost associated with the increase in pension benefits related to years of service credited in a pension plan amendment.

Straight-Line Basis

A method of calculating depreciation and amortization by evenly spreading the cost of an asset over its useful life.

Pension Retirement Benefits

Long-term benefits or compensations provided to employees upon retirement, which may include contributions made by the employer to a pension plan.
